Further support

In addition to regular or work-related support you may require other kinds of advice or support during your PhD project. If so, you can turn to the following persons:

HR-officers/-advisors
Every faculty or institute has several HR-officers/-advisors, whom you can consult with questions regarding your appointment, career, development and training and various other questions related to your contractual obligations and rights.

PhD candidate coordinator/ PhD candidate dean
Several faculties or institutes have a coordinator or dean for all PhD candidate-related affairs. The coordinator or dean acts as the go-to person for PhD candidates and in some cases conducts initial and progress interviews. To find out who have been appointed as PhD candidate coordinators or deans visit your faculty website.

Coaching and career counselling
If things are not going well in your PhD project or if you feel you need some external advice (for instance regarding your career), you can contact the university's Staff Development Team. There you will find a (career) coach who can give you specific, tailor-made counselling throughout your PhD project.

Department of Occupational Health & Safety and Environmental Service
The Radboud University Department of Occupational Health & Safety and Environmental Service can also answer any work-related health questions, for instance through its university medical officers specialised in the field of healthy work environment and the prevention of health problems.
